Output c452888bcf7995a293e1906e90a5f8f0566e4dc77fc6d88b0d1ae4143022b124:0

value
596893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2198d8c4e56e276c34b053fc7624ae913ef9d6 OP_EQUAL
address
3JkUXnDxbdCksurEFUpzHhyowuMpXS9hoA
transaction
c452888bcf7995a293e1906e90a5f8f0566e4dc77fc6d88b0d1ae4143022b124
spent
true